dc.descriptionI discuss an application of numerical techniques for massive two-loop Feynman diagram evaluation to a phenomenologically very important rare decay process, B -> X_s l+l-. This process, currently being measured at B factories, has been calculated at two-loop level in the lower dilepton invariant mass perturbative window by a previous collaboration. We extended this result, by using numerical integration methods, to the whole observable spectrum of the dilepton invariant mass consistent with the perturbative QCD regime.
